well if you were with us on wednesday you will have seen the amazing report by our correspondent pallab ghosh about the use of electronic implants in the brain of paralysed man which enabled him to walk again. well it might sound like it s the stuff of science fiction films, but electronic brain implants took a step closer today. an experimental company called neuralink founded by elon musk says it has won clearance from us regulators to carry out its first clinical study on a human. it s working on brain implants to treat conditions such as paralysis and blindness, and to help some disabled people communicate with computers. eventually, the company says it wants to surpass able bodied human performance with its technology. well, speaking to me now is nita farahany, professor of philosophy at duke law university and an expert on the ethical, legal and social implications of emerging technology. welcome to the programme what do you make of all of this? i welcome to the pro ....
